Subject: Cold starts on the Quillbeam handlers

Hey — welcome to the rota! Quick heads-up before your first shift: our serverless handlers on the Fernhollow platform get sluggish after quiet periods. First request after a cold start can take 8–10 seconds, and the synthetic checks sometimes flag it as an outage. It usually isn't one. Check the warm-pool dashboard first, and only page the platform folks if latency stays high after three consecutive probes. The full cold-start playbook lives on the page below.

runbook for badug-kadup: https://confluence.zemvarlabs.internal/projects/browse/display/projects/bd1b

## Changelog — Ticktrace 1.9

### Renamed: DRIFT_API_TOKEN
During the cron drift investigation we found plugins confusing this variable with the metrics token, so it has been renamed to indicate it authorizes drift-report uploads specifically. Plugin authors must read the new name from 1.9 onward; the old name is ignored without warning. Sample env files in the SDK are updated. In your deployment env file, the drift-report upload secret is set on the next line.

env line for fawef-taguf: VAULT_KEY13=a9695905a9a90

**Q: What happens if Keyturner fails mid-rotation?**

Keyturner, our internal secrets-rotation utility, writes a checkpoint before each rotation step. If a run aborts, do not re-run blindly — first roll back to the checkpoint from the Keyturner console so downstream services keep valid credentials. The rollback command prompts for the checkpoint recovery passphrase, which is recorded on the following line.

unlock words, yahif-yajef: kasok-julax-norael-gorael-istox-normir-istael

☐ Step 9 — Hot-reload check. Confirm the Marrowgate config daemon applies changes without restart by toggling the canary flag and watching the reload counter increment. A stale counter means the watcher died; restart it before key generation. Once hot-reload is verified, unlock the ceremony config store with the recovery passphrase given below.

recovery phrase for kawep-kawep: caseth-gorael-quenmir-olieth-ulavan-fenwyn-eliix-fraox-zorok